#dce272 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#dce272 is composed of 86.3% red, 88.6% green and 44.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 2.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 49.6%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 63.2 degrees, a saturation of 65.9% and a lightness of 66.7%. #dce272 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ffe4 with #b9c500. Closest websafe color is: #cccc66.

#dce272 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#dce272 has RGB values of R:220, G:226, B:114 and CMYK values of C:0.03, M:0, Y:0.5,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 14475890.
